View this edWebinar to learn practical instructional classroom strategies that CAN engage and focus students toward becoming successful and empowered readers and writers who can read the words AND learn to understand what they read.

This recorded edWebinar is of interest to PreK-12 teachers, librarians, school and district leaders, and education technology leaders.

Joanna LewisAbout the Moderator

Joanna Lewis has worked at McGraw Hill as a literacy specialist since 2015. In her current role as the senior literacy product marketing manager for the Digital Acceleration Group, Joanna supports the intersection of product development, marketing, and sales. Before her role with supplemental literacy, Joanna was a senior curriculum specialist focusing on PreK–12 literacy. As a literacy specialist, Joanna worked closely with district leaders, school administrators, specialists, and teachers to provide print and digital literacy solutions for improved instruction and student achievement. Prior to joining McGraw Hill, Joanna worked for 19 years in education as a reading specialist, technology integration teacher, and classroom teacher. She received her Master of Science in Education, Reading Specialist and a Certificate in Administration and Supervision from the Johns Hopkins University in Baltimore, Maryland.
